Overview

Offering a shopping area, the 4-star Motel One Madrid-Plaza De Espana lies in the Moncloa-Aravaca district, around 25 minutes' stroll from Prado National Museum and a mere 0.8 miles from Museo de Historia de Madrid. Located only a few minutes from the ancient Egyptian temple "Templo de Debod", this perfect hotel overlooks the urban and invites guests to have a drink at a snack bar.

Location

The motel is located in a business area of Madrid, 1.4 miles from Real Basilica de San Francisco el Grande. The modern Motel One Madrid-Plaza De Espana is situated about 5 minutes by foot from Museo Cerralbo and right near Ventura Rodriguez subway station.

This property is located 16 miles from Adolfo Suarez Madrid-Barajas airport and 0.2 miles from Martires de Alcala bus stop.

Rooms

There are 92 rooms at Motel One Madrid-Plaza De Espana, each of them has climate control, as well as entertainment amenities such as a flat-screen TV with satellite channels. Guests will make use of a hairdryer and bath sheets in the private bathrooms equipped with a separate toilet and a shower.

Eat & Drink

Breakfast is served from 7:00 AM to 11:00 AM on weekends. The modern bar is also available. While staying at the Madrid hotel, guests can choose from dining options nearby, such as Sushita Cafe, located approximately 800 feet away, or Puntarena at a 5-minute walking distance.

Leisure & Business

There is a fitness room at the Motel One Madrid-Plaza De Espana.

    Motel One in Madrid delivered a good stay. The room felt spacious with comfy beds, and the bathroom was modern with high-quality fittings. The cleanliness stood out as top-notch. I loved that the hotel was brand new and quiet, despite being centrally located close to Plaza de España. The bar in the entrance lounge added a nice touch to relax after a day out. the breakfast seemed a bit overpriced at 13 euros per person, especially when many good cafes are nearby, offering better value. I noticed a lack of extra toiletries in the room, which felt a bit inconvenient. The air conditioning worked well, which is essential in the summer heat. I did enjoy the location's proximity to the metro and vibrant dining options. A separate bin for recycling would have been a welcome addition too.
